>>You've got a couple problems mixed together here.
>>
>>(1) Swap space fills up because you have overcommitted memory. In principle,
>>filling up swap space has nothing to do with "thrashing".
>>(2) "thrashing" is a characteristic of a poorly performing program in a
>>demand paging virtual memory system typically caused by trying to run a
>>program with a resident size that is smaller than required. Systems can
>>thrash without filling up swap space. It is true that systems can thrash AND
>>fill up swap space, but it is not always so.
>>
>>You either need (1) more main memory, (2) reduce the number of programs you
>>are running simultaneously, or (3) better behaving programs, or all three.
>>Increasing the amount of swap space will just use more disk. It won't cause
>>your system to stop thrashing since that is driven by what is going on in
>>memory, not what is going on on the disk.
>
>
> Not necessarily. Increasing swap can allow more physical RAM to be used for
> caching data from disk.
>
> Imagine a system with limited physical RAM, and limited swap space, running a
> process which causes a lot of filesystem activity on the same physical disk
> as is being used for swap. If the total RAM, both physical and swap is almost
> completely full, increasing the swap space may allow some data from physical
> RAM to be swapped out, in favour of caching filesystem data from the disk.
>
> Without knowing more details of the original poster's machine, it's difficult
> to give specific advice about how to solve the problem.

1 GB RAM desktop machine, with 32 MB swap, kernel 2.6.3. In normal
operation, the swap is 80% free. It started the thrashing when I loaded
a HUGE page (generated from a database) in konqueror.

The issue is not to solve _my_ problem, I really don't care about it
that much, the issue would be to solve this sort of problem for
everyone. I've had disk thrashing with filled up swap on a server
(kernel 2.4) and that was much worse. Anyway, I'll start using swapd
and see what happens. Some time in the future, I'll post here the
conclusion.
